SQL Flashcards

1
Q

SQL Definition

A
  • Datendefinitionssprache
  • Datenmanipulationssprache
  • Anfragesprache
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

Löschen von Tupeln

A

delete Studenten

where Semester > 13;

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

Verändern von Tupeln

A

update Studenten

set Semester= Semester + 1;

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

SQL-Anfrage

A

select PersNr, Name
from Professoren
where Rang= ‘C4’;

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

Sortierung

A

select
from
order by … desc, … asc;

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
6
Q

Duplikateliminierung

A

select distinct

from

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
7
Q

Anfragen über mehrere Relationen

A

select
from
where …and…;

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
8
Q

Mengenoperationen und geschachtelte Anfragen

A

( select Name from Assistenten)
union
( select Name
from Professoren);

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
9
Q

Mengenoperationen

A

union, intersect, minus

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
10
Q

Aggregatfunktionen

A

avg, max, min, count, sum

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
11
Q

Geschachtelte Anfrage

A

select *
from pruefen
where Note < ( select avg (Note) from pruefen );

How well did you know this?
1
Not at all
2
3
4
5
Perfectly